#E93023 Hex Color Code

#E93023

The Hexadecimal Color #E93023 is a contrast shade of Crimson. #E93023 RGB value is rgb(233, 48, 35). RGB Color Model of #E93023 consists of 91% red, 18% green and 13% blue. HSL color Mode of #E93023 has 4°(degrees) Hue, 82% Saturation and 53% Lightness. #E93023 color has an wavelength of 617.48148n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#E93023 is #FF3333.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#E93023 is #E32. The Closest Color to #E93023 is #DC143C. Official Name of #E93023 Hex Code is Alizarin Crimson.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#E93023 is 0 Cyan 79 Magenta 85 Yellow 9 Black and #E93023 CMY is 0, 79, 85.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#E93023 is hsl(4,82,53,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(4, 85, 91).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#E93023 is 34.97, 19.56, 3.52.
Hex8 Value of #E93023 is #E93023FF. Decimal Value of #E93023 is 15282211 and Octal Value of #E93023 is 72230043. Binary Value of #E93023 is 11101001, 110000, 100011 and Android of #E93023 is 4293472291 / 0xffe93023.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#E93023 is 0.602, 0.337, 0.337 and YIQ Color Space of #E93023 is 101.833, 114.4184, 35.0819.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#E93023 is 33.46, 8.62, 3.83.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#E93023 is 51.34, 68.04, 52.38.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#E93023 is 51.34, 143.4, 34.07.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#E93023 is 51.34, 85.87, 37.59. Hunter Lab variable of #E93023 is 44.23, 63.74, 26.24.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#E93023

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
